Thy Kingdom Gone is a concept album[1] and the sixth full-length album by the German gothic metal band Flowing Tears. The cover art was made by Seth Siro Anton, who has previously worked with bands such as Moonspell, Soilwork, and Paradise Lost.[1] The song "Thy Kingdom Gone" features male vocals of Vorph from Samael.
